This is a new look at Pinot Noir through a white wine lens. Central Otago Pinot Noir grapes were hand-picked and quickly pressed then fermented as white juice. The result is a fresh and energetic white wine perfect for summer and something a little different. The nose displays red apple, honeysuckle, and strawberry. The palate is sweetly fruited, fresh and lively, with notes of red apple, melon and a touch of spice. Best to serve chilled.
Rabbit Ranch Chardonnay is made to express the very best of Central Otago's cool climate, unique schist soils and grand vistas. Handpicking, whole bunch pressing, minimal intervention and oak result in an expressive, energetic wine displaying the typical white floral and ripe citrus notes that are a hallmark of the region's best Chardonnay.
